Enhanced Potassium-Stimulated γ-Aminobutyric Acid Release by Astrocytes Derived from Rats with Early Hepatogenic Encephalopathy
Authors:Jan Albrecht  Urszula Rafaowska
Institution:Department of Neuropathology, Medical Research Center, Polish Academy of Sciences, Warszawa, Poland;Department of Neurochemistry, Medical Research Center, Polish Academy of Sciences, Warszawa, Poland
Abstract:Bulk-isolated astrocytes from rats with early hepatogenic encephalopathy (HE) induced with thioacetamide responded to the increase of potassium in the incubation medium from 5 mM to 75 mM with a markedly enhanced release of previously taken up 14C]gamma-aminobutyric acid (14C]GABA). The process was not affected by omission of calcium and/or addition of EGTA to the incubation medium. Only a slight stimulation of GABA release by high potassium was observed in astrocytes from control rats. In contrast, histamine and histidine were vigorously released from control astrocytes in high-potassium medium, and their release was not enhanced by HE, indicating that the observed phenomenon is specific for GABA.
